The final four for the shortlist to be the UK’[s first City of Culture in 2013 have been chosen. They are Birmingham, Derry/Londonderry, Norwich and Sheffield.
They were chosen from a long list of 14 by a panel chaired by Phil Redmond, the television producer and creative director of Liverpool in its year as European Cultural Capital in 2008.
“The panel was influenced by the expected step change each city was asked to envisage, if they gained the title and subsequent media spotlight” he said.
“It was a hard choice but also heartening that all bidders had recognised the power of culture to bring people together; to work collectively within existing resources for a common goal and bring into being networks that may not have existed before.”
The four will now have to make final bids to be in by the end of May, and in the summer Redmond’s panel will see presentations from them before announcing the eventual winner.
